About this map

Santa Maria Reservoir Elevation 9465 dominates the central landscape of this Mineral County survey, sitting just below Santa Maria Pass and the prominent Long Ridge. The map documents a rugged high-altitude environment within the Rio Grande National Forest, where the terrain transitions from the heights of Table Mountain and Bristol Head down toward the Rio Grande in the southeast corner.
